Evolution does not use Kwallet. It's a Gnome app and uses gnome-keyring
for passwords. You can set up the keyring using Seahorse. Unfortunately
this means that you will still have to type in the master password for
the keyring when Evo starts in a new session. There's a way round this
if you're using the KDM desktop manager, but not currently with the
newer SDDM. Check the list archives for more information.
